I took all of the hull strength calculation formulae in the ABS guidelines and wrote them into a MATLAB program which attempts to optimize the hull design. The program isn't done yet, but when it is it should save lots of time. Using a provided minimum internal diameter and working depth, the program uses a lookup table of structural sections with their properties, and iterates through hull designs using every possible combination of stiffener section, number of heavy stiffeners, number of non-heavy stiffeners, internal versus external stiffening, and incremental plate thicknesses starting with the provided minimum diameter, to converge on a solution which results in the lowest overall volume of steel necessary for fabrication.
